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our team will arrive at your property to assess the damage and create a customized plan to address the issue. We’ll identify the source of the leak and find out the best course of action to prevent further damage.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We’ll use specialized equipment to extract water from your property, including wet/dry vacuums and submersible pumps. Our technicians will work efficiently to remove as much water as possible to prevent further damage.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
We’ll use industrial-grade dehumidifiers and air movers to dry your property and prevent mold growth. Our technicians will work to ensure your property is dry and safe within 3-5 days.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
Once the drying process is complete, our team will clean and sanitize your property to prevent mold and bacterial growth. We’ll use eco-friendly cleaning products to ensure your property is safe and healthy.
Step 5: Restoration and Repair
Our team will work with you to restore your property to its original condition. This may include repairing or replacing damaged materials, such as drywall, flooring, or cabinets.

Warning Signs You Need Bathtub Overflow Water Removal
Bathtub overflow water removal is a serious issue that needs prompt attention. Ignoring these warning signs can lead to further damage, costly repairs, and even health risks. Here are some common warning signs you need bathtub overflow water removal: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, unpleasant odors in your bathroom or surrounding areas may show a bathtub overflow. These odors can be a sign of mold growth or bacterial contamination, which can pose health risks if left unchecked.
Water Stains on Ceilings or Walls
Water stains on your ceilings or walls can be a sign of a bathtub overflow. These stains can show water damage, which can lead to costly repairs and even structural issues if left unaddressed.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of a bathtub overflow. This type of damage can lead to costly repairs and even create safety hazards if left unaddressed.
Visible Water Damage
Visible water damage, such as standing water or water-soaked materials, is a clear sign of a bathtub overflow. This type of damage needs prompt attention to prevent further damage and costly repairs.
Unusual Sounds or Leaks
Unusual sounds or leaks from your bathtub or surrounding areas can show a bathtub overflow. These sounds or leaks can be a sign of a faulty drain or other issues that need prompt attention.

Bathtub Overflow Water Removal Cost in Crockett Mills, TN
The cost of bathtub overflow water removal in Crockett Mills, TN, can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our team will provide a free estimate after assessing the damage and determining the best course of action.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and removal | $500 – $2,500 | Severity of the damage, size of the affected area |
| Drying and dehumidification | $300 – $1,500 | Size of the affected area, type of equipment needed |
| Cleaning and sanitizing | $200 – $1,000 | Size of the affected area, type of cleaning products needed |
| Restoration and repair | $1,000 – $5,000 | Severity of the damage, type of materials needed |
| More services (mold remediation, etc.) | $500 – $2,000 | Severity of the issue, type of services needed |
